The Facts on Net Neutrality
Imagine this scenario: You use your favorite search engine, as you do every day, to find a local business. But the nearby hardware store you’re looking for doesn’t show up. Instead, you get redirected to the new big chain store in town. This may seem harmless, and some people might not even notice. In reality, though, it’s unfair to the small hardware shop, and it’s unfair to you, forcing on you something you’re not looking for.
Soon enough, this might not be a hypothetical situation. Legislation is currently making its way through Congress to change the Internet’s structure and the very way it operates. Like many people and organizations who want the Internet to remain a free and open society, Aplus.Net supports “net neutrality” provisions to this legislation to ensure that the level playing field that is today’s Internet is not destroyed.

The best place to start our journey is the U.S. government’s own agency dedicated to small business issues. The United States Small Business Administration, or SBA, was created in 1953 to “maintain and strengthen the nation's economy by aiding, counseling, assisting and protecting the interests of small businesses and by helping families and businesses recover from national disasters.”
It may seem unusual for the government to take such an interest into what many assume is a small part of the American economy. The truth, however, is quite the opposite: Small businesses are an enormous part of our economy. According to an August 2005 press release, the SBA states:
“Small business drives the U.S. economy by providing jobs for over half of the private workforce … Data and research shows that small businesses represent 99.7 percent of all firms, they create more than half of the private non-farm gross domestic product, and they create 60 to 80 percent of the net new jobs … In 2004, there were an estimated 23,974,500 businesses in the U.S. Of the 5,683,700 firms with employees, 5,666,600 were small firms (fewer than 500 employees) … American entrepreneurs are creative and productive, and these numbers prove it.”2
The SBA’s website offers helpful rundowns on how to start, finance, and manage a new business. There’s also a useful section dedicated to business opportunities. A page on disaster recovery outlines the “long-term, low-interest” loans available to small businesses that have suffered from natural disasters, and offers advice on how to minimize damage if a disaster hits your region.
Even if your business is already past the point of being able to profit from this information, it’s still a good idea to check out the SBA’s website to get the government’s perspective on small business. In the process, you just might stumble on to some benefits you didn’t know you were entitled to. So take advantage—after all, the SBA is funded by your tax dollars. Subcontracting, instructions on registering your business in the government’s contractor database, contract procurement assistance, and links to federal business opportunities are just a few more of the useful resources offered by the SBA.
